在网站页面的表格上显示抓取的更新数据可以通过以下步骤来实现:
- 抓取数据:首先,您需要编写一个程序或脚本来定期抓取所需的数据。可以使用爬虫框架(如Scrapy)或编程语言中的相关库(如Python的BeautifulSoup)来完成数据的抓取工作。
- 数据处理:抓取到数据后,您需要对其进行处理和清洗,以便将其转换为表格中所需的格式。这可能包括去除无用的信息、处理数据的格式和结构等。
- 存储数据:将处理后的数据存储到数据库或文件中,以便在需要时进行访问和更新。常用的数据库包括MySQL、PostgreSQL、MongoDB等,您可以根据实际需求选择适合的数据库。
- 后端开发:在后端开发中,您可以使用适合的编程语言和框架来构建一个API,用于提供从数据库中获取数据的接口。您可以使用Node.js的Express框架、Python的Django框架或Java的Spring框架等。
- 前端开发:在网站的前端页面中,您可以使用HTML、CSS和JavaScript来创建一个表格,并通过AJAX请求从后端获取数据并更新表格。您可以使用jQuery、Vue.js、React等前端框架来简化开发过程。
- 定时刷新数据:为了保持数据的实时性,您可以使用JavaScript的定时器或WebSocket来定期向后端发送请求以获取最新的数据,并更新显示在表格中。
- 错误处理:在开发过程中,可能会出现各种问题和错误。为了提高系统的稳定性和用户体验,您需要适当地处理和报告错误,例如添加错误日志、异常处理等。
- 安全性考虑:在开发过程中,您还需要考虑数据的安全性。确保您的应用程序具有适当的身份验证和授权机制,并防止潜在的安全漏洞。
对于腾讯云相关产品,可以考虑使用腾讯云的云服务器(CVM)作为后端服务器,使用腾讯云数据库(TencentDB)来存储数据。另外,腾讯云还提供了丰富的云计算服务,如腾讯云对象存储(COS)用于存储静态资源、腾讯云函数计算(SCF)用于处理后端逻辑等。您可以根据实际需求选择适合的产品。
以上是一个基本的实现流程,根据实际需求和技术栈的不同,具体的实现方式可能会有所差异。